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Catkin Yew | Olive Brownie |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Fungi (Fungi) |
| Phylum | Coniferophyta (Conifers) | Basidiomycota (Club Fungi) |
| Class | Pinopsida (Conifers) | Agaricomycetes (Mushrooms) |
| Order | Pinales (Pines & Allies) | Agaricales (Gilled Mushrooms) |
| Family | Taxaceae | Strophariaceae |
| Genus | Amentotaxus | Hypholoma |
| Species | Amentotaxus argotaenia | Hypholoma myosotis |
